Emerging C-suite roles like Chief AI Officer and Chief Sustainability Officer popped up as businesses scrambled to handle AI explosions and ESG pressures. These aren’t vanity titles. They sit at the intersection of strategy, risk, and opportunity. Companies without them risk falling behind on innovation, regulation, and stakeholder demands.

  • Chief AI Officer (CAIO) drives AI strategy, governance, and scalable adoption while managing risks like ethics and security.
  • Chief Sustainability Officer (CSO) integrates environmental, social, and governance (ESG) priorities into core operations for long-term resilience and compliance.
  • These roles matter because traditional C-suite structures can’t keep pace with tech acceleration and regulatory scrutiny.
  • Early adopters gain competitive edges in efficiency, talent attraction, and investor confidence.
  • Expect more hybrid titles as AI and sustainability overlap.

Why These Roles Exploded in Prominence

Boards woke up. AI isn’t a side project anymore—it’s rewriting workflows across every function. Sustainability shifted from nice-to-have PR to board-level risk and opportunity.

In my experience, organizations that treat these as add-ons watch their initiatives fizzle. Dedicated leaders make them stick. Deloitte notes the complexity of modern business pushed specific roles tied to priority domains. Half of companies now juggle four or more C-level tech roles.

The kicker? These positions report high, often straight to the CEO, giving them real teeth.

Breaking Down the Chief AI Officer Role

The CAIO owns the AI agenda. Strategy. Execution. Guardrails.

They identify high-value use cases, build data foundations, oversee model deployment, and hammer home governance—bias, privacy, compliance with evolving rules like the EU AI Act. Many also tackle workforce transformation so people actually use the tools.

LinkedIn data showed CAIO numbers nearly tripled in recent years. Surveys put adoption between 26% and 60%+ depending on company size and sector, with heavy presence in tech, finance, and healthcare.

Here’s the thing. A great CAIO doesn’t just chase shiny models. They tie AI directly to revenue, cost savings, or customer outcomes. Fail there and you get expensive experiments with zero ROI.

The Chief Sustainability Officer in Action

CSOs moved far beyond recycling reports. They embed sustainability into strategy, supply chains, product design, and investor reporting.

Expectations skyrocketed with regulations, investor pressure, and consumer scrutiny. Companies with strong CSOs often score higher on ESG ratings. The role increasingly links to financial performance and risk management.

Top CSOs influence everything from Scope 3 emissions to talent strategies that attract purpose-driven workers. Many now sit closer to operations or even legal as compliance tightens.

Side-by-Side Comparison

AspectChief AI Officer (CAIO)Chief Sustainability Officer (CSO)
Core FocusAI strategy, adoption, governance & innovationESG integration, compliance & long-term value
Key ResponsibilitiesUse case prioritization, model risk, scalingEmissions tracking, stakeholder engagement, reporting
Primary RisksBias, security breaches, regulatory finesClimate litigation, reputational damage, supply chain disruption
Metrics That MatterROI on AI projects, adoption rates, model accuracyESG scores, carbon reduction targets, SBTi alignment
Typical BackgroundTech/AI leadership, data science, strategyEnvironmental science, operations, finance/ESG
Overlap PotentialUsing AI for sustainability reporting & optimizationLeveraging AI tools for accurate ESG data

This table shows clear distinctions yet natural synergies. Smart companies make these leaders collaborate.

How Emerging C-Suite Roles Like Chief AI Officer and Chief Sustainability Officer Drive Business Impact

Emerging C-suite roles like Chief AI Officer and Chief Sustainability Officer deliver when given real authority.

CAIOs accelerate digital transformation without the chaos. CSOs future-proof operations against regulatory and climate shocks. Together, they help companies attract capital—investors increasingly demand both AI readiness and sustainability credibility.

One fresh analogy: Think of the CAIO as the engine tuner and the CSO as the safety inspector and route planner for a high-speed cross-country race. Miss either and you either crash or run out of fuel.

What usually happens is companies hire these roles reactively after a crisis or missed opportunity. Proactive ones build the muscle earlier and pull ahead.

Step-by-Step Action Plan for Beginners

Want to understand or step into these worlds? Here’s what I’d do:

  1. Build foundational knowledge. For AI, master basics of machine learning, prompt engineering, and data ethics. For sustainability, dive into ESG frameworks, carbon accounting, and circular economy principles.
  2. Gain hands-on experience. Lead a departmental AI pilot or sustainability project. Track measurable results.
  3. Develop cross-functional skills. Learn to speak finance, operations, and boardroom language. Shadow leaders or join cross-team initiatives.
  4. Pursue targeted credentials. Consider certifications in AI governance or sustainability reporting (e.g., GRI standards). Advanced degrees help but real results matter more.
  5. Network aggressively. Attend industry events, connect with current CAIOs/CSOs on LinkedIn, and study how they frame their wins.
  6. Demonstrate leadership. Volunteer for high-visibility projects that bridge tech and responsibility.

Start small. Deliver wins. Scale your influence.

Common Mistakes & How to Fix Them

Mistake 1: Treating the role as purely technical.
Fix: Anchor everything in business outcomes. CAIOs who ignore change management watch adoption die. CSOs who skip financial ties lose board support.

Mistake 2: Isolating the function.
Fix: Build alliances with CIO, CFO, and COO from day one. Explore PwC’s insights on Chief AI Officer priorities.

Mistake 3: Overpromising timelines.
Fix: Set realistic pilots, measure rigorously, then scale. Hype without proof kills credibility.

Mistake 4: Ignoring talent gaps.
Fix: Invest in upskilling existing teams alongside hiring specialists.

FAQs

What qualifications do most Chief AI Officers have?

Many come from technology leadership, data science, or strategy backgrounds with deep AI implementation experience. Business translation skills often prove more decisive than pure coding ability.

How does the Chief Sustainability Officer role differ from traditional CSR?

CSOs focus on strategic integration, risk management, and measurable business impact through ESG, while older CSR efforts leaned more toward philanthropy and communications.

Can smaller companies afford emerging C-suite roles like Chief AI Officer and Chief Sustainability Officer?

Yes—often by starting with fractional or combined roles. The principles scale; full-time hires come as complexity grows. Many mid-sized firms embed responsibilities into existing leadership first.
